Volunteer Battalion. I 9 Battalion Orders by Lieut.-Col. W. X. Jones, commanding 1st Battalion, Car- marthenshire Volunteer Regiment.—Drill Hall, Llanelly. Week ending 13th Oct.— Monday, 7.25 p.m., N.C.O.'s Class. Tuesday, 7.25 p.m., Extended Order Drill. Wednesday, 7.25 p.m., Musketry. Thursday, 7.25 p.m., Physical Drill. Friday, 7.25 p.m., Company Drill. Di-ess.-Pi,iin clothes; Armlets to be worn. ArBiiets.—N.C.O.'s and men in posses- sion of Armlets will return same to store at the Drill Hall, Murray street. Sections A, B and C.—Enrolled mem- j bers can enter Sections A, B and C (as eligible) hy signing Army Form V. 4010, on v.,u-i, of the above drill nights or during l the day-time at the temporary offices of j the Battalion. (Signed) A. G. Thomas, Major, I Acting Adjutant 1st Bat. Carm. Vol. Rgt
